前端编程是一个热门的职业方向,具有广阔的就业前景。以下是一些建议学习的前端技术和方向,这些技术和方向在当前市场上非常热门且有很好的就业前景:
HTML/CSS
HTML:用于创建网页的结构。
CSS:用于网页的样式和布局。
建议:这是前端编程的基础,几乎所有的前端开发岗位都需要熟练掌握这两个技术。
JavaScript
JavaScript:前端编程中最重要的语言之一,用于实现网页的交互和动态效果。
建议:掌握JavaScript可以让你开发出更加复杂和丰富的前端应用。
前端框架和库
React、 Vue.js、 Angular:这些框架能够帮助开发者更高效地构建用户界面,并且在市场上有很高的需求。
建议:学习并掌握这些流行的前端框架和库,可以显著增加你的就业竞争力。
响应式设计
响应式设计:使网页在不同设备上有良好的显示效果,包括手机、平板和桌面电脑。
建议:随着移动设备的普及,响应式设计已成为前端开发的必备技能。
移动端开发
React Native、 Flutter:跨平台开发技术,或者学习原生的iOS和Android开发。
建议:移动设备的普及使得移动端开发成为一个重要的就业方向。
前端性能优化
代码压缩、 懒加载、 CDN加速:提高网页的加载速度和用户体验。
建议:学习前端性能优化的技巧,能够提高网页的加载速度和用户体验,这在就业市场上非常有竞争力。
UI/UX设计
用户界面(UI)设计和 用户体验(UX)设计:在前端开发中起着重要的作用。
建议:学习UI/UX设计的知识,如用户研究、信息架构和可用性测试,可以让你更全面地理解用户需求并提供更好的用户体验。
数据可视化
D3.js、 Echarts:将复杂的数据以图表、地图等可视化的方式展示出来。
建议:学习掌握数据可视化工具,可以为你在数据分析和数据可视化方面找到好的就业机会。
版本控制工具
Git:用于代码的版本控制和协作开发。
建议:掌握版本控制工具,如Git,可以提高你的开发效率和团队协作能力。
跨浏览器兼容性
建议:了解不同浏览器的兼容性问题,确保前端应用在各种浏览器上都能正常运行,这也是一个重要的就业竞争力。
建议
选择与你的兴趣和职业规划相匹配的前端技术和方向。如果你对计算机科学和编程有浓厚的兴趣,并且希望在前端开发领域长期发展,那么计算机科学与技术或软件工程是很好的选择。此外,随着移动设备的普及,移动端开发和响应式设计也成为非常重要的技能,值得重点学习和掌握。